3种深松铲对深松作业效果影响研究

摘    要:深松是实施保护性耕作、获取农作物高产必不可少的机械化作业项目。研究表明,深松机的深松部件——深松铲的形状和结构参数对土壤深松质量及作业效果有很大的影响。对比凿型深松铲、箭型深松铲和双翼深松铲深松后的效果,结果表明:在相同条件下,凿型深松铲在打破犁底层后改善土壤持水量、土壤温度和土壤坚实度方面的综合作用效果好。

Experimental Analysis on the Subsoiling Effect of Three Subsoilers

Abstract:Deep tillage is an important part of protective cultivation technique aiming at high yields.Researches show that the shapes and structure parameters of subsoiler have a significant impact on the operation quality and operation efficiency.Comparisons are made between subsoilers of chisel type,subsoilers of arrow type,and double wing subsoilers.The results show that under the same conditions,subsoilers of chisel type achieve better results in improving soil water-holding capacity,soil temperature,and soil compatibility after it breaks the tillage pan.
